When the tough-on-crime politics of the 1980s overcrowded state prisons, private companies saw potential profit in building and operating correctional facilities. Today more than a hundred thousand of the 1.5 million incarcerated Americans are held in private prisons in twenty-nine states and federal corrections. Private prisons are criticized for making money off mass incarceration―to the tune of $5 billion in annual revenue. Based on Lauren-Brooke Eisen’s work as a prosecutor, journalist, and attorney at policy think tanks, Inside Private Prisons blends investigative reportage and quantitative and historical research to analyze privatized corrections in America.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Lauren-Brooke Eisen","offers":[{"title":"Bueno \/ 2019","offer_id":43718427803722,"sku":"97802311797133","price":9580.0,"currency_code":"CLP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0224\/7871\/7002\/files\/81BLPUeI-tL.jpg?v=1781736060","url":"https:\/\/www.greenlibros.com\/products\/97802311797133","provider":"Green Libros","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
